When God's Timing Feels Late is a deeply honest, faith-filled book for anyone navigating the difficult, unseen seasons of waiting. Written for both women and men, this book meets you in the space between promise and fulfillment-where faith is tested, hope feels fragile, and obedience requires courage. Through powerful chapters and guided devotionals, you'll be reminded that waiting is not wasted time. It is often where God does His most important work-shaping your character, refining your trust, and preparing you for what you've been praying for.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ationEmihle Bande is a South African writer who specialises in short stories, poetry, children's books, and self-empowerment books. Known for her warm and uplifting voice, she creates stories that inspire hope, confidence, and imagination. Recognised as one of Sunday World's Heroic Women, Emihle's work is rooted in compassion and community upliftment. She is also a podcaster, speaker, and brand ambassador for The Warrior Project, using her platforms to empower young people-especially women-to believe in their worth and purpose.
